HILL TOPS RAIN DISRUPTED PRACTICE

Kent man Jake Hill kicked off his home race weekend by topping a drizzly Kwik Fit British Touring Car Championship Free Practice session at Brands Hatch.

It was dry when the hour-long session commenced, hence the majority of the fastest laps being set early on before a downpour of rain descended on the famous venue.

Hill’s MB Motorsport accelerated by Blue Square Honda has always been a potent weapon around the 1.2-mile Indy circuit and that proved to be the case again in mixed dry-wet conditions.

“I love Brands,” said Hill. “It’s my home and we’ve always gone well here. That’s the second free practice session we’ve topped here this year so that’s good.

“It’s been a great start to the morning, can’t get any better than that! 

“I’m feeling ready for it definitely. The car’s really great. It’s hooked up and we’ve definitely got something left in the tank so I’m feeling positive.”

The performance followed yesterday’s news that Hill will be staying with the same outfit for the 2021 BTCC season.

“It’s fantastic to sign with MB Motorsport accelerated by Blue Square for 2021,” he continued. “The team’s been fantastic to me this year and we know that if we hadn’t had those engine issues at the start that we’d be heading into this final fight for the championship as well. I’m very happy with where I am and I can’t wait to get going with them next year. 

“I’m going to just do my thing this weekend and obviously try my best to not get tangled up with anyone. It’s their championship to lose. If they want to play the game with me they’re going to have to try hard.”

Despite the rain, more than 1000 laps were completed by the field as the track remained busy for the duration. 

Title contenders Ash Sutton, Dan Cammish, Tom Ingram and Rory Butcher were close behind on the timesheets, with Laser Tools Racing’s Aiden Moffat among them. 

The two Excelr8 Motorsport Hyundais of Chris Smiley and Senna Proctor were inside the top, as was Motorbase Performance’s Ollie Jackson and BTC Racing’s Josh Cook.

2020 Kwik Fit British Touring Car Championship – Free Practice – Brands Hatch Indy

1        Jake HILL (GBR) MB Motorsport accelerated by Blue Square 54.678s
2        Ashley SUTTON (GBR) Laser Tools Racing +0.225s
3        Dan CAMMISH (GBR) Halfords Yuasa Racing +0.330s 
4        Aiden MOFFAT (GBR) Laser Tools Racing +0.376s 
5        Tom INGRAM (GBR) Toyota Gazoo Racing UK with Ginsters +0.393s
6        Rory BUTCHER (GBR) Motorbase Performance +0.515s
7        Ollie JACKSON (GBR) Motorbase Performance +0.610s 
8        Chris SMILEY (GBR) Excelr8 Motorsport +0.753s
9        Josh COOK (GBR) BTC Racing +1.024s 
10      Senna PROCTOR (GBR) Excelr8 Motorsport +1.039s 
11      Tom OLIPHANT (GBR) Team BMW +1.048s
12      Tom CHILTON (GBR) BTC Racing +1.078s 
13      Adam MORGAN (GBR) Carlube TripleR Racing with Mac Tools +1.111s
14      Colin TURKINGTON (GBR) Team BMW +1.125s
15      Matt NEAL (GBR) Halfords Yuasa Racing +1.202s
16      Jack GOFF (GBR) RCIB Insurance with Fox Transport +1.207s
17      Michael CREES (GBR) The Clever Baggers with BTC Racing +1.452s
18      Stephen JELLEY (GBR) Team Parker Racing +1.530s 
19      Andy NEATE (GBR) Motorbase Performance +1.641s
20      Glynn GEDDIE (GBR) RCIB Insurance with Fox Transport +1.691s
21      Nicolas HAMILTON (GBR) ROKiT Racing with Team HARD +1.702s
22      Sam OSBORNE (GBR) MB Motorsport accelerated by Blue Square +1.838s
23      Carl BOARDLEY (GBR) HUB Financial Solutions with Team HARD +2.056s
24      Paul RIVETT (GBR) GKR TradePriceCars.com +2.210s
25      Brad PHILPOT (GBR) Power Maxed Car Care Racing +2.358s
26      Jack BUTEL (GBR) Carlube TripleR Racing with Mac Tools +2.489s
27      Ethan HAMMERTON (GBR) GKR TradePriceCars.com +2.629s
